Star Wars Celebration has given us our first glimpse of Rory McCann stepping into the role of Baylan Skoll for Season 2 of Ahsoka, following the untimely passing of Ray Stevenson. McCann, known for his captivating performances, is now set to take on the mantle of this pivotal character.
While we haven't seen McCann in action yet, the Ahsoka panel at Star Wars Celebration provided us with an exclusive first-look image, which you can see below.
Ray Stevenson, who previously portrayed Baylan Skoll and was celebrated for his roles in films like Thor, RRR, Punisher: War Zone, and the series Rome, tragically passed away from a brief illness just three months before Ahsoka's premiere. Many fans and critics alike have hailed Stevenson's performance as Baylan as one of the standout elements of the series so far.
Ahsoka series creator Dave Filoni openly discussed the profound impact of losing Ray Stevenson, describing it as "one of the biggest challenges in developing Season 2," and praised Stevenson as "the most beautiful person on screen and off."
During the panel, Filoni and the production team also shared insights into what fans can expect in Season 2. Excitingly, Hayden Christensen will reprise his role as Anakin Skywalker, and we'll see the return of beloved characters such as Admiral Ackbar, Zeb, Chopper, and more.
